The Thrill of Formula 1: A New Era Begins with Hamilton and Leclerc
Formula 1, often referred to as F1, is not just a sport; it’s a spectacle that sparks excitement and passion among racing fans around the world. With the new season on the horizon, all eyes are on the iconic teams and their drivers as they prepare for the challenges ahead. This year, the air is filled with energy at Fiorano, Italy, where two of the sport’s most talented drivers, Lewis Hamilton and Charles Leclerc, are set to make history. Hamilton, a seven-time world champion, has switched teams, and for the first time, he is stepping into a Ferrari car, the SF-25.

The Ferrari SF-25: Innovation Meets Speed
One of the most exciting aspects of this pre-season buzz is the debut of the new Ferrari SF-25. Motorsport experts like Gary Anderson have been analyzing this innovative beast, and the findings are intriguing. When it comes to Formula 1, it’s not just about who can drive the fastest; it’s also about the technology behind the car. The SF-25 is designed to be faster, more agile, and equipped with advancements that could give Ferrari a competitive edge this season.
So, what makes the SF-25 special? First, it features cutting-edge aerodynamic designs, which help in optimizing airflow around the car. This crucial aspect affects speed and stability. Imagine riding a bike; if your bike has better aerodynamic features, you can go faster and smoother without using too much energy. That’s the kind of thinking that goes into the SF-25.
Another point of focus is the new hybrid power unit, which Ferrari has developed. Hybrid units combine traditional fuel engines with electric components, and they are becoming increasingly important in F1. Not only do they help with speed, but they also promote a more sustainable approach to racing. As awareness about climate change grows, F1 is making strides towards eco-friendly racing, and Ferrari is at the forefront of this evolution.
